This is a letter sent in accounting for a historic 15,000 mile trip in just two months straight.

by Hubert & Christine Mueller- 

Hi everyone from Malaysia! I have just completed the first stage of my trip of a lifetime... 

Having retired last September, I went to the USA in search of my dream car. Having searched the world for the best car for my needs (spirited cruising) there is no doubt that (the Superformance) is the car for me... There she was, all shiny and new- titanium/black strip 418 stroker- with 100 miles on her! What a great day it was!!! ...After a break-in cruise to visit a friend in Akron, Ohio and... off to Altoona, Penn to get Branda ...emblems. Arrived 4:30pm in light drizzle (she's not babied) to the total astonishment of the guys there. I thought that they would have seen lots of cars like these but they told me it's all mail order (seems no one likes to drive their cars!!) They loved the car and were impressed with the quality and finish! Thought I was nuts for driving it in the rain!! 

...(I) bought "Most Scenic Drives in America", then off to the Appalachian Mnts. Foggy & Raining!! ...picked up my wife at the airport (arriving from Malaysia) and attended the (SSR-2 event in Ross, Ohio)!! Met so many nice people!! Had a great time and are planning to come again next year!!! ...off to New Orleans via Nashville and Memphis. Then Shreveport, through Arkansas and the Ozark Mnts (scenic drive) to St.Louis. Tornado's were pretty bad in Missouri and at one gas stop a guy tried to talk me into putting my car into his garage until the next day because of the weather. He had a mint 1968 Firebird in his garage and was willing to put it out in the rain for me. Now that's what I call hospitality!! That evening we did run into some heavy rain (understatement-the MarkIII does float!!!) 

Up the Mississippi to Rochester, Minn and the Mayo clinic where... (my Superformance) was the star there too as it was parked right outside the hotel main entrance for 4 days and became quite the conversation piece on the shuttle bus back & forth to the clinic. Met some nice people there too! Took 85 year old Frank from Chicago for a ride! He was there for a heart attack (before the ride!) He loved it!! Hope for us all!!! ...7000 miles on speedo! 

From Indiana to St.Louis, then followed Route 66 to Flagstaff, Arizona, then Phoenix, Tuscon, San Diego, LA, up the west coast to Vancouver and Victoria,Canada (where I grew up) and a week of relaxation!! ...Then off to LasVegas to lose some money and HIT THE RACE TRACK!!!(3 hours all by myself with instructor in my car!) ...Then to LA and into the container, strapped her down, sealed the container and an airplane home. Now waiting again - (patiently for the 6 week journey across the Ocean)!! 

All in all - 14988 miles on the speedometer of (my Superformance)!! in TWO and a bit months!! And I'm Still Married!! WHAT A GREAT CAR !!!!!!!
